Sweden has taken first steps toward implementing the VAT in the Digital Age (ViDA) package, adopted by the EU Council in March 2025. The Swedish Government has issued a committee directive (Dir. 2026:9) commissioning a special investigator to assess how the ViDA rules should be transposed into national law.
The investigation is scheduled to present its findings by 30 November 2027. This will be followed by consultation periods and legislative drafting before any legislation can be adopted by parliament. It is therefore unlikely that Sweden will be ViDA-ready well in advance of the 2030 deadline.
